why rung 1
≈15 conv/mo from product campaigns

≈15 conversions per month. Google learns confidently from 30 — that's enough for 1 campaign.

safe to do now
one campaign, two at most: "Maximize conversions" or "Maximize conversion value"
gather most products into one main campaign, excluding obvious budget wasters
if you already have many campaigns — merge them so Google gets more conversions
80-90% of the budget on the main campaign
not yet
split into more than 2 campaigns — there won't be enough conversions for each
inflate the target ROAS or lower the target CPA before you reach the goal
Bring one strong campaign to 30-50 conversions per month — that's Google's learning threshold — then you can split. See what to exclude ↗

Lose conversions (sales events or dropped products) — and the rung goes down. Check the assortment first, then the structure.

Once the account reaches 30 conversions/mo, GetProfit builds a recommended campaign structure for your catalog — core and tail with separate tROAS.

Learn more — what the structure will look like

GetProfit's algorithm labels every product by its 12-month performance (labels on the «Products» tab) and splits products across campaigns, each with its own goal:

WST

Core — bestsellers and profitable tail

steady sellers: protect impression share, higher tROAS

N

Test — newcomers

products with no history get their first impressions on a separate small budget

MLZD

Limit — budget drain

unprofitable and dormant products are cut off: they no longer receive budget

Budget flows to the winners and each group learns on its own goal — so Google's algorithm stops optimizing «on average».
